Abstract
The utility model discloses a kind of portable blood detection and analysis card, which is any one in following (I)~(II): (I) the detection and analysis card is any one in Blood grouping reagent card, four detection reagent cards of infectious disease, ALT detection reagent card and hemoglobin detection reagent card;(II) the detection and analysis card includes at least two in Blood grouping reagent card, four detection reagent cards of infectious disease, ALT detection reagent card and hemoglobin detection reagent card, and two adjacent detection reagent cards are combined and spliced together by connector.Using micro whole blood sample, the detection of blood screening entry is completed on a portable inspectiont analyzing card, accurate interpretation is carried out to testing result with portable blood fluorescence immunity analyzer, and will test after data carry out finishing analysis inside analyzer and export, so that tester is obtained intuitive detection interpretation result.Portable blood tests and analyzes card and is convenient for carrying, and can be detected at any time, blood screening detection before being suitble to field operation promptly to transfuse blood, and also can operate with all kinds of preoperative, blood safety screening detection before taking a blood sample.

Key Term is explained:
A) portable: its be mainly characterized by it is easy to carry, it is light and have stronger shock-resistance features, be suitble to field situation make
With.
B) blood safety screening: different general individual event screening, the blood safety screening mentioned in this patent are comprehensive
Entry screening, usual blood screening include that blood group ABO and blood group RhD sizing detect according to national regulation, and alanine amino turns
Move enzyme detection, hemoglobin detection, infectious disease four (hepatitis B surface antibody, AIDS, syphilis, hepatitis) detection;Preoperative blood sieve
It looks into.
C) fluorescence immunoassay: used fluorescence immunoassay label that cross-linking method is immunized with antigen-antibody in this patent.
D) it analysis system: is tested and analyzed in this patent comprising portable blood fluorescence immunity analyzer and portable blood
Card, is collectively referred to as the safe screening fluoroimmunoassay system of portable blood.

Embodiment 1, portable blood test and analyze card
Portable blood, which tests and analyzes to block, uses solid phase percolation, fluorescence immune chromatography method, and three kinds of dry chemical detection method
The square foundation science of law.Wherein blood group ABO and RhD sizing detection are using solid phase percolation, and infectious disease four using fluorescence
Immunochromatographic method, alanine aminotransferase (ALT) and hemoglobin (Hb) are using dry chemical detection method.Portable blood
Test and analyze the following Fig. 1 and Fig. 2 of card structure schematic diagram:
Portable blood test and analyze card can be used as multinomial comprehensive detection reagent mode card use it is also decomposable after as
Individual event detection reagent mode card uses, and each single deck tape-recorder of individual event detection reagent mode card passes through the male and female that Fig. 2 (round frame) is identified
Knot that can be undone by a pull is connected, and the multinomial comprehensive detection reagent mode card of Fig. 1 is combined into.
Portable blood, which tests and analyzes card, can be analyzed to four independent individual event detection reagent cards: Blood grouping reagent card 1,
Four detection reagent cards 2 of infectious disease, 4 four parts of ALT detection reagent card 3 and hemoglobin detection reagent card.Above-mentioned four
Individual event detection reagent card is successively secondary to be combined splicing by male knot that can be undone by a pull 5 and female knot that can be undone by a pull 6, and the bottom of each reagent card is respectively equipped with plate
Rib 7 is for positioning.
As shown in figure 3, Blood grouping reagent card 1 divides for 103 3 upper cover 101, pedestal 102 and Blood grouping strip portions
Point, upper cover 101 can be closely chimeric at an entirety by plate muscle column with pedestal 102, and the Blood grouping strip 103 is placed
In the card slot of pedestal 102, the upper cover 101 is equipped with location hole 101-1 and blood group well 101-2, the blood group
Well 101-2 corresponds to the blood group sample application zone of Blood grouping strip 103;There is positioning plate rib 7 on the pedestal 102, is used for
Location reagent is stuck in the placement location on portable blood fluorescence immunity analyzer.
The Blood grouping strip 103 is using diafiltration and chromatography compages, and structure is as shown in figure 4, lowest level base
Plate 103-1 is polyester fiber board, and layer is successively overlapped III 103-2 of blotting paper, II 103-3 of blotting paper, blotting paper I as shown on it
103-4, cushion 103-5, antibody pad 103-6.Antibody pads 103-6 and cushion 103-5 lap constitutes blood group sample application zone,
It is corresponding with the blood group well 101-2 of Fig. 3.Sample contacts after being added with antibody pad 103-6, and auxiliary liquid aid sample is added later
Be percolated from top to bottom, II 103-3 of blotting paper drains the liquid of diafiltration by chromatography scheme, III 103-2 of blotting paper then into
One step prevents liquid accumulator, reaction is promoted to be normally carried out by surplus liquid diafiltration drainage and toward reversed chromatography.
As shown in figure 5, described four detection reagent cards 2 of infectious disease divide for upper cover 201, pedestal 202 and infectious disease four
203 3 parts of strip are detected, upper cover 201 can be closely chimeric at an entirety, infectious disease four by plate muscle column with pedestal 202
Item detection strip 203 is arranged in the corresponding card slot of the pedestal 202, and upper cover 201 is equipped with observation window 201-1, label window
Mouth 201-2, sample application hole 201-3, chromatography auxiliary liquid well 201-4, observation window 201-1 correspond to infectious disease four detections
NC film 203-3, sample application hole 201-3 and chromatography auxiliary liquid well 201-4 in strip 203 respectively correspond infectious disease four
The sample application zone and chromatography auxiliary liquid sample application zone in strip 203 are detected, has positioning plate rib 7 on pedestal 202, is used for location reagent card
Placement location on portable blood fluorescence immunity analyzer.
The fluorescence immune chromatography method that the infectious disease four detection strips 203 use, foundation structure is as shown in fig. 6, certainly
Glass pad 203-1, antibody pad 203-2, NC film 203-3 and substrate 203-4 are disposed under above, the glass pads 203-1
One end and one end of antibody pad 203-2 partly overlap, the other end and the NC film 203-3 of antibody pad 203-2
One end partly overlap, the other end of the NC film 203-3 is partially covered with blotting paper 203-5;The sample application zone is located at institute
The top of glass pad 203-1 is stated close to the part of antibody pad 203-2, the chromatography auxiliary liquid sample application zone is located at the sample-adding
Area is down at 4mm.Four detection strips 203 of infectious disease are tied using polyester sheet as substrate 203-4 using the basis of general chromatography
Structure, the albumen of fluorescence signal is marked in coating on antibody pad 203-2, carries out immune cross-linking reaction, NC with target detection albumen
Test line and control line are coated on film 203-3, as test and quality control index.
